Cliff: The Man with a Seagull on his Head by Gareth Hopkins, Illustrated by Alex Latimer

PUBLICATION DAY REVIEW!

Luckily for Cliff, a seagull lands on his head and decides to stay there! Delighted to have company, Cliff is surprised when the townspeople are not happy about him encouraging the seagull.

Soon Cliff and his seagull feel so unwelcome, they stop going to town. As their supplies begin to run out, the seagull decides Cliff would be happier on his own and flies away.

Poor Cliff feels lonelier than ever and sets off in his boat, determined to find his seagull. When a storm hits, there’s only way he can be rescued, but will the townspeople learn to trust the seagull?


A heartwarming story of friendship and a great way to encourage a love of all birds, even ones who have a reputation for pilfering chips and ice cream!

The illustrations by Alex Latimer are clear, bright and filled with all of the humour and the darkness of this seaside story.
